Kate Middleton stepped away from her usual midi-dress style for a polished appearance at the 2026 Commonwealth Games in Glasgow, Scotland, and fans are still talking about her effortlessly chic ensemble.
The Princess of Wales attended the event with Prince William and their three children—Prince George, 13, Princess Charlotte, 11, and Prince Louis, 8—on August 1.
For the family outing, Kate opted for a sophisticated combination of classic separates instead of one of her signature dresses. She wore a deep racing-green double-breasted cashmere blazer by Ralph Lauren over a black-and-white Breton-striped knit top.

The mom of three paired the pieces with a classic white pleated midi skirt, creating a timeless contrast between the dark green tailoring and crisp white skirt.
Kate finished the outfit with a chalk-colored woven tote from Anya Hindmarch, tan slingback pumps by Camilla Elphick and delicate pearl drop earrings.
The royal kept her beauty look understated, wearing soft makeup with pink lips and subtle green eyeshadow that complemented her blazer. She wore her brown hair loose in a side-parted style with soft waves.
The Prince and Princess of Wales also shared a family photo from the event on their official Instagram account, writing, “Incredible atmosphere at the Commonwealth Games today. Watching world-class talent compete and seeing the power of sport to bring people together is truly special. Thank you to everyone involved for such a wonderful day.”
